1. The Anatomy of a Custom Mechanical Keyboard

To understand the high-end market, one must first break down the keyboard into its core components. Unlike mass-produced membrane keyboards, a custom build is modular. Every single piece is selected by the user to achieve a specific sound profile (often referred to as "thock" or "clack") and a precise typing feel.

The Case and Plate Materials

The foundation of any premium build is the case. Cheap plastic is completely absent in this tier.

  • CNC Machined Aluminum: The gold standard for enthusiast boards. A solid block of anodized aluminum provides immense weight (sometimes exceeding 5 lbs), which absorbs high-frequency pings and keeps the board firmly planted on a premium desk mat.

  • Polycarbonate (PC): Favored for its deeper acoustic resonance and its ability to diffuse RGB under-glow beautifully.

  • The Mounting Style: High-end boards utilize "Gasket Mounting." Instead of screwing the internal plate directly to the metal case, the plate is sandwiched between strips of shock-absorbing poron foam or silicone. This provides a softer, cushioned typing feel that reduces finger fatigue during long coding sessions.

Keycaps: The Visual Identity

Keycaps dictate both the aesthetic and the texture of the keyboard. Enthusiasts routinely spend upwards of $150 just for the keycaps.

  • Double-Shot PBT: The highest quality manufacturing process. Two separate layers of plastic are injected into a mold. The legend (the letter) is a physical piece of plastic running through the keycap, meaning it will literally never fade or rub off, regardless of how many millions of times it is pressed.

  • Artisan Keycaps: Hand-crafted, custom-sculpted individual keys made from resin or metal, often used as the Escape key to add a unique, personalized flair to the build.

2. The Switch Revolution: Beyond Mechanical

The mechanical switch is the heart of the keyboard. While traditional Cherry MX style switches (Linear, Tactile, and Clicky) still dominate the market, 2026 has brought massive technological leaps in how keystrokes are registered.

Hall Effect and Magnetic Switches

For competitive gamers and high-speed typists, traditional copper-leaf mechanical switches are being replaced by Hall Effect Switches.

  • How They Work: Instead of a physical metal contact, these switches use a magnet and a sensor to measure the exact distance the key is pressed.

  • Rapid Trigger Technology: Because the sensor knows the exact position of the switch dynamically, the user can reset the keystroke the instant they lift their finger, rather than waiting for the switch to travel back up past a fixed reset point. This provides a massive advantage in fast-paced e-sports titles.

Custom Keyboard Firmware (QMK / VIA)

High-end custom keyboards are essentially tiny computers. They utilize Custom Keyboard Firmware like QMK or VIA, which allows users to remap every single key on a hardware level. A software developer can program complex macros, dual-function keys (where a short tap types a letter, but holding it acts as the "Shift" key), and multiple layers, vastly improving workflow efficiency without relying on bloated background software.

3. Layouts and Form Factors: Shrinking the Footprint

The traditional full-size 104-key layout is largely ignored in the enthusiast space. Modern professionals prioritize mouse space and ergonomic positioning.

Keyboard Form Factor Key Characteristics Ideal User Profile
Tenkeyless (TKL / 80%) Removes the number pad but keeps the function row and arrow keys. Traditional gamers and general office workers.
75% Layout Compresses the TKL layout into a tight block. Keeps dedicated arrow keys and a function row. Mac users, video editors, and laptop-dock users.
65% Layout Removes the function row entirely (accessed via an FN layer) but retains arrow keys. Software developers and digital minimalists.
Ergonomic Split Keyboards Physically split into two halves. Reduces ulnar deviation and wrist strain. Writers, developers, and users prioritizing posture and health.

4. Why the Custom Keyboard Market is an E-Commerce Goldmine

For e-commerce entrepreneurs, the mechanical keyboard niche is incredibly lucrative due to the deeply passionate community and the recurring nature of the purchases.

The "Endgame" Myth

In the keyboard community, the "Endgame" is the theoretical perfect keyboard that will stop you from ever buying another one. It is a myth. Enthusiasts constantly chase new sound profiles, new switch materials (like UHMWPE plastics), and new case designs. Once a customer enters the hobby, their Lifetime Value (LTV) skyrockets as they continually purchase new switches, custom coiled aviator cables, and specialized lubricants.

The Group Buy Model

Unlike traditional retail, many high-end keyboards are sold through "Group Buys." Customers pre-order the product, and manufacturing only begins once the funding goal is reached. This creates extreme exclusivity and allows boutique designers to bring innovative products to market with zero upfront capital risk.

5. Acoustic Tuning and Keyboard Modding

Building the keyboard is only half the battle; tuning it is where true enthusiasts shine. Acoustic engineering is a major part of the hobby.

  • Lubing Switches: Enthusiasts spend hours opening each individual switch and applying high-grade synthetic grease (like Krytox 205g0) to the plastic stems and metal springs. This eliminates any scratching noises and creates a buttery-smooth feel.

  • Tape Mods and Foam: Adding layers of painters tape to the back of the PCB (Printed Circuit Board) or inserting high-density EVA foam into the case acts as a sound filter, absorbing harsh frequencies and amplifying the coveted "thock" sound.
